Kubernetes (K8S) 是一个开源的容器管理平台,它可以用来自动部署、扩展和操作容器化的应用程序。K8S调度器(prefilter)是K8S中非常重要的一个组件,它可以决定将Pod调度到哪个节点上运行。在本篇文章中,我将向你介绍K8S调度器(prefilter)的实现及相关代码示例。
### K8S调度器(prefilter)流程
首先,让我们来看一下K8S调度器(prefilter
原创
2024-04-12 11:12:13
149阅读
spring security中可以通过表达式控制方法权限: Spring Security中定义了四个支持使用表达式的注解,分别是@PreAuthorize、@PostAuthorize、@PreFilter和@PostFilter。其中前两者可以用来在方法调用前或者调用后进行权限检查,后两者可以
原创
2022-09-02 16:09:15
138阅读
spring security中可以通过表达式控制方法权限:Spring Security中定义了四个支持使用表达式的注解,分别是@PreAuthorize、@PostAuthorize、@PreFilter和@PostFilter。其中前两者可以用来在方法调用前或者调用后进行权限检查,后两者可以用来对集合类型的参数或者返回值进行过滤。要使它们的定义能够对我们的方法的调用产生影响我们需要设置glo
原创
精选
2022-02-24 17:04:58
280阅读
鉴权,路由转发,统一的错误返回格式等等 细化来分的话 我们可分三类过滤器。PreFilter、PostFilter、E
转载
2023-07-21 23:44:55
133阅读
zuul中的Filter的配置,zuul中提供了三种类型的Filter,preFilter,routeFilter和postFilter,分别对应请求中的不同的阶段,针对同一个请求,有一个RequestContext对象,在三个阶段的Filter中进行共享假设我们要开发一个统计请求时间的功能,需要在preFilter里边记录开始时间,并将整个开始时间放在RequestContext中,在p...
原创
2021-07-30 15:16:16
299阅读
zuul中的Filter的配置,zuul中提供了三种类型的Filter,preFilter,routeFilter和postFilter,分别对应请求中的不同的阶段,针对同一个请求,有一个RequestConte...
转载
2020-04-10 08:25:00
281阅读
2评论
基于表达式的权限控制目录1.1 通过表达式控制URL权限1.2 通过表达式控制方法权限1.2.1 使用@PreAuthorize和@PostAuthorize进行访问控制1.2.2 使用@PreFilter和@PostFilter进行过滤1.3 使用hasPermission表达式 Spring Secur
转载
2022-11-08 23:32:20
253阅读
在spring security安全管理框架中,主要注解有@EnableGlobalMethodSecurity@Secured (角色认证)@PreAuthorize(访问方法之前进行 权限或角色 认证)@PostAuthorize(访问方法之后进行 权限或角色 认证)@PreFilter (过滤参数集合)@PostFilter (过滤返回值集合)@EnableGlobalMethodSecur
转载
2024-04-08 08:52:45
261阅读
Spring Security权限控制可以配合授权注解使用,Spring Security提供了三种不同的安全注解:Spring Security自带的@Secured注解;JSR-250的@DenyAll、@RolesAllowed、@PermitAll注解;表达式驱动的注解,包括@PreAuthorize、@PostAuthorize、@PreFilter和 @PostFilter;一、权限控
转载
2023-11-27 00:12:13
83阅读
1. 权限注解Spring Security权限控制可以配合授权注解使用。Spring Security提供了三种不同的安全注解:Spring Security自带的@Secured注解;JSR-250的@RolesAllowed注解;表达式驱动的注解,包括@PreAuthorize、@PostAuthorize、@PreFilter和 @PostFilter。1.1 @Secured在Sprin
转载
2024-03-29 15:59:52
92阅读
文章目录前言本次测试注解介绍注解使用@Secured@PreAuthorize@PostAuthorize@PostFilter@PreFilter代码下载 前言之前security中,针对配置项进行了相关的配置和测试。但是这些都是基于在security.config.MyConfig#configure(org.springframework.security.config.annotatio
转载
2024-05-15 11:18:01
97阅读
Spring Security 3.0提供了一些新的注释,以便在方法级上全面支持数据权限访问控制。有四个属性注释支持表达式允许pre和post-invocation授权检查,支持过滤收集参数或返回值。他们是@PreAuthorize, @PreFilter, @PostAuthorize and @PostFilter。启用这些注解必须在spring boot项目中添加@EnableGlobalM
转载
2024-03-15 12:23:13
115阅读
一,区别Spring Security中定义了四个支持使用表达式的注解,分别是 @PreAuthorize,@PostAuthorize,@PreFilter,@PostFilter: 其中前两者可以用来在方法调用前或者调用后进行权限检查,后两者可以用来对集合类型的参数或者返回值进行过滤。 要使它们的定义能够对我们的方法的调用产生影响我们需要设置global-method-secur
转载
2024-04-01 08:39:23
83阅读
为了深入学习 kube-scheduler,本系从源码和实战角度深度学 习kube-scheduler,该系列一共分6篇文章,如下:
kube-scheduler 整体架构
初始化一个 scheduler
一个 Pod 是如何调度的
如何开发一个属于自己的scheduler插件
开发一个 prefilter 扩展点的插件
开发一个 socre 扩展点的插件
上一篇,我们说了 kube-sche
原创
2023-04-20 22:59:55
97阅读
为了深入学习 kube-scheduler,本系从源码和实战角度深度学 习kube-scheduler,该系列一共分6篇文章,如下:
kube-scheduler 整体架构
初始化一个 scheduler
一个 Pod 是如何调度的
如何开发一个属于自己的scheduler插件
开发一个 prefilter 扩展点的插件
开发一个 socre 扩展点的插件
上一篇,我们说了 kube-sche
原创
2023-04-20 22:52:05
42阅读
为了深入学习 kube-scheduler,本系从源码和实战角度深度学 习kube-scheduler,该系列一共分6篇文章,如下:
kube-scheduler 整体架构
初始化一个 scheduler
一个 Pod 是如何调度的
如何开发一个属于自己的scheduler插件
开发一个 prefilter 扩展点的插件
开发一个 socre 扩展点的插件
上一篇,我们说了 kube-sche
原创
精选
2023-04-20 23:00:30
273阅读
Spring Security权限控制机制Spring Security中可以通过表达式控制方法权限,其中有四个支持使用表达式的注解,分别是@PreAuthorize、@PostAuthorize、@PreFilter和@PostFilter。其中前两者可以用来在方法调用前或者调用后进行权限检查,后两者可以用来对集合类型的参数或者返回值进行过滤。启动Security机制的配置它们的定义能够对我们的
转载
2024-07-12 02:26:58
211阅读
提示:文章写完后,目录可以自动生成,如何生成可参考右边的帮助文档 文章目录前言一、利用Ant表达式实现权限控制;二、利用授权注解结合SpEl表达式实现权限控制1.授权注解2.代码实现三. 利用过滤器注解实现权限控制1.过滤器注解简介2.@PostFilter的用法3.@PreFilter的用法四.利用动态权限实现权限控制1. 数据库表结构2.实现UserDetails接口3. 实现UserDeta
文章目录一、通过表达式控制URL权限二、 通过表达式控制方法权限 一、通过表达式控制URL权限二、 通过表达式控制方法权限Spring Security中定义了四个支持使用表达式的注解,分别是@PreAuthorize、@PostAuthorize、@PreFilter和@PostFilter。其中前两者可以用来在方法调用前或者调用后进行权限检查,后两者可以用来对集合类型的参数或者返回值进行过滤
转载
2024-07-11 19:48:25
39阅读
之前我写过一篇文章Spring Cloud Zuul(路由转发与过滤器)里边大概讲解了zuul的路由转发和过滤器,这篇文章我们实践一下zuul的过滤器在项目中的使用。我们一般在项目中用网关要做很多的事情,一般有用户鉴权,路由转发,统一的错误返回格式等等细化来分的话 我们可分三类过滤器。PreFilter、PostFilter、ErrorFilter。(当然可以在细化一个RoleFilter,一般情
转载
2024-06-03 12:44:25
286阅读